About Tiago Faria
Tiago Faria is a scholar working on Health, Toxicology and Mutagenesis, Process Chemistry and Technology and Chemical Health and Safety, having authored 54 papers that have together received 1.1k indexed citations. Recurring topics across this work include Air Quality and Health Impacts (28 papers), Indoor Air Quality and Microbial Exposure (28 papers) and Occupational exposure and asthma (15 papers). The work is most often cited by research in Health, Toxicology and Mutagenesis (838 citations), Process Chemistry and Technology (69 citations) and General Dentistry (32 citations). Tiago Faria has collaborated with scholars based in Portugal, Greece and Finland. Frequent co-authors include Carla Viegas, Susana Marta Almeida, Susana Viegas, Anita Quintal Gomes, Vânia Martins, Elisabete Carolino, Liliana Aranha Caetano, Konstantinos Eleftheriadis, Evangelia Diapouli and Manousos Ioannis Manousakas. Their work appears in journals such as The Science of The Total Environment, Environmental Pollution and Atmospheric Environment.
